Bug 42334 - Длинные имена элементов дерева некорректно отображаются
Summary: Длинные имена элементов дерева некорректно отображаются
Status: CLOSED FIXED
Alias: None
Product: Branch p10
Classification: Unclassified
Component: admc (show other bugs)
Version: не указана
Hardware: x86_64 Linux
: P5 normal
Assignee: Дмитрий Дегтярев
QA Contact: qa-p10@altlinux.org
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2022-04-04 18:50 MSK by Evgeny Shesteperov
Modified: 2023-07-10 13:25 MSK (History)
3 users (show)

See Also:


Attachments
скриншот (61.10 KB, image/png)
2022-06-20 14:01 MSK, Alexander Makeenkov
no flags Details
Скриншот 1.png (48.15 KB, image/png)
2022-07-14 16:50 MSK, Sergey Ivanov
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description Evgeny Shesteperov 2022-04-04 18:50:02 MSK
Версия
======

Name        : admc
Version     : 0.9.0
Release     : alt1
DistTag     : p10+297620.100.1.1

Шаги воспроизведения
====================

1) Раскрыть папку Объекты групповой политики.
2) Нажать правой кнопкой мыши на политику -> Переименовать.
3) Ввести в поле Имя максимально допустимое количество символов -> Применить

Аналогично для Сохраненных запросов.

Ожидаемый результат: корректное отображение длинных имен, наличие скроллов

Фактический результат: политика с длинным именем отображается в левом фрейме некоррекно, нет скролла, чтобы прочитать имя до конца.
Если выставить фокус на длинной политике, то вид интерфейса страдает: правый фрейм разъезжается на весь экран.
Comment 1 Дмитрий Дегтярев 2022-06-08 13:30:25 MSK
Исправлено. Будет доступно в 0.10.0.
https://github.com/altlinux/admc/commit/be3b850e20d35cc8c62804380cdf88a50daf41c6
Comment 2 Alexander Makeenkov 2022-06-20 14:01:09 MSK
Created attachment 10944 [details]
скриншот

Версия пакета: admc-0.10.0-alt1

Ошибка исправлена, но не до конца.
В левом фрейме появляется скролл, но при нажатии на политику правый фрейм всё так же открывается на весь экран (см. скриншот).
Comment 3 Дмитрий Дегтярев 2022-06-21 15:16:04 MSK
(In reply to Alexander Makeenkov from comment #2)
> Ошибка исправлена, но не до конца.
> В левом фрейме появляется скролл, но при нажатии на политику правый фрейм
> всё так же открывается на весь экран (см. скриншот).

Исправил так чтобы правая панель не меняла ширину из-за слишком длинного текста в строке описания. Строка описания теперь применяет word wrap для текста внутри.
Comment 4 Sergey Ivanov 2022-07-14 16:49:41 MSK
(Ответ для Дмитрий Дегтярев на комментарий #3)
> (In reply to Alexander Makeenkov from comment #2)
> > Ошибка исправлена, но не до конца.
> > В левом фрейме появляется скролл, но при нажатии на политику правый фрейм
> > всё так же открывается на весь экран (см. скриншот).
> 
> Исправил так чтобы правая панель не меняла ширину из-за слишком длинного
> текста в строке описания. Строка описания теперь применяет word wrap для
> текста внутри.

http://webery.altlinux.org/task/302107
Name        : admc
Version     : 0.10.0
Release     : alt1
DistTag     : p10+302107.500.5.1

Ошибка всё ещё воспроизводится (скриншот 1.png)
При этом нельзя уменьшить ширину правого фрейма
Comment 5 Sergey Ivanov 2022-07-14 16:50:03 MSK
Created attachment 11117 [details]
Скриншот 1.png
Comment 6 Samael 2023-04-26 16:16:12 MSK
Исправлено в 0.12.0